directed by Luchino Visconti.  Italy, France, 1957, 102 min.

To tell Dostoevsky's tale, Visconti reinvented a city on the water, thick with fog and snow, a dreamlike labyrinth where two young people's sentiments lose their way.  This film strikes the perfect balance between theatre and cinema, enhanced by the handsome Mastroianni's splendid performance.
